“Inspiring the Future of Work by Attitude and Worktech”: that's what SAATKORN stands for as a blog and podcast.Since its founding in 2009, more than 2,000 blog posts and 500 podcast episodes have been created—always with the aim of shedding light on the interface between people and technology in the context of work.WorkTech defines what is technologically possible. Attitude determines whether and how this translates into real impact.

    #539 How is AI transforming global talent migration, Dr. MATTHIAS MAUCH?

    In this episode of the SAATKORN Podcast, I’m talking to Dr. Matthias Mauch, Managing Director Germany at TERN, a company building technology to accelerate global talent migration. TERN combines AI-powered recruiting with complex immigration and integration processes to connect skilled workers from around the world with employers in Germany. Matthias is a passionate entrepreneur who originally co-founded a language school network in Tunisia that later evolved into a global recruiting infrastructure for healthcare and technical talent. Today, his team uses AI, data, and human support to bring qualified professionals from countries like India, Morocco, or Tunisia to Germany.
